Industry Metal Corrosion Protection

Metal corrosion protection products are applied on different metals to protect them against corrosion. The most common type of corrosion is rust. When a metal comes in contact with surrounding environment elements like water or air rust appears. When corrosion affects a metal it means that the metal is destructed by the chemical or electrochemical reactions involved in the rusting process. Metal corrosion protection products are most often used to protect steel pipelines and metals used in the oil, gas and building industries, but can be used even in the electrical industry as insulation resins for motor armatures and stators and bus bars at temperatures of 180°C.

For the protection of steel fibers and synthetic materials used to reinforce the concrete structure constructors use polyolefin. In the case of oil and gas industry, metal corrosion protection is fulfilled by a new pipeline pending security system that protects from any kind of damage pipelines or underground assets. Oil and gas pipelines are real hard to maintain because they are covering very long distances and they are exposed to any kind of damaging process, even common corrosion, which can lead to huge expenses and problems.

The new metal corrosion protection system for pipelines is a new technique, needed for all oil or gas companies, because in the past the maintenance of pipelines involved a lot of people personnel, process with low efficiency. This metal corrosion protection technique involves sensing units each having a unique ID that is installed along the pipelines at a depth between the pipes themselves and the ground that make and alarm sound for the operators. These kind of sensing units are software components that can be regularly updated. They work on batteries that can last five years in the wireless mode.
